The Peanut Butter and Jelly Cookie is a soft, chewy treat that combines the classic American sandwich flavors into a baked dessert. It typically features a peanut butter dough base with a sweet fruit jelly or jam filling, often dropped in the center before baking. This cookie is a popular homemade staple across the United States, beloved for its nostalgic, comforting taste.

🍽️ Nutrition at a glance

This cookie is high in both carbohydrates and fat, primarily from sugars, flour, peanut butter, and butter. It provides a quick energy boost along with some plant-based protein and a small amount of fiber, with a typical serving containing roughly 150-200 calories.

💡 What's interesting

The cookie is a direct, edible homage to the iconic PB&J sandwich, a cultural touchstone of American childhood and convenience food. Nutritionally, it offers a more indulgent, dessert-focused version of the sandwich's core flavor profile, swapping bread for cookie dough.
